PATENTS

1906. -----. [KÖLBEL, H., AND ACKERMANN, P.] (Steinkohlen-Bergwerk "Rheinpreussen"). [Synthesis Catalyst.] German Patent 752,480, no date; appl. St. 60,776 (Cl. 12 o-1.03). Kainer, p. 78. Auszüge deut. Patent-Anmeldungen, vol. 6, p. 361.

Iron catalysts for the hydrogenation of CO are made by precipitating Fe salt solutions with earth alkali carbonates or hydroxides. If desired substitution of these precipitating agents can be made by alkali if the washed-out precipitate is later treated with earth-alkali compounds, particularly barium nitrate solutions.
